Condividi tramite


LOWER (Transact-SQL)

Restituisce un'espressione di caratteri dopo aver convertito i caratteri maiuscoli in caratteri minuscoli.

Si applica a: SQL Server (SQL Server 2008 tramite versione corrente), Database SQL di Windows Azure (versione iniziale tramite versione corrente).

Icona di collegamento a un argomento Convenzioni della sintassi Transact-SQL

Sintassi

LOWER ( character_expression )

Argomenti

  • character_expression
    Espressione di dati di tipo carattere o binario. character_expression può essere una costante, una variabile o una colonna. Il tipo di dati dell'argomento character_expression deve supportare la conversione implicita in varchar. In caso contrario, utilizzare CAST per convertire l'argomento character_expression in modo esplicito.

Tipi restituiti

varchar oppure nvarchar

Esempi

Nell'esempio seguente vengono utilizzate la funzione LOWER e la funzione UPPER, quindi la funzione UPPER viene nidificata nella funzione LOWER per la selezione dei prodotti con prezzi compresi tra 11 e 20. In questo esempio viene utilizzato il database AdventureWorks2012.

SELECT LOWER(SUBSTRING(Name, 1, 20)) AS Lower, 
   UPPER(SUBSTRING(Name, 1, 20)) AS Upper, 
   LOWER(UPPER(SUBSTRING(Name, 1, 20))) As LowerUpper
FROM Production.Product
WHERE ListPrice between 11.00 and 20.00;
GO

Set di risultati:

Lower Upper LowerUpper

--------------------- --------------------- --------------------

minipump MINIPUMP minipump

taillights - battery TAILLIGHTS - BATTERY taillights - battery

(2 row(s) affected)

Vedere anche

Riferimento

Tipi di dati (Transact-SQL)

Funzioni per i valori stringa (Transact-SQL)